码农也不是那么容易当的


什么是码农呢?只是简单的实现功能吗?一直都在强调复用性,易用性,高性能,在编码的时候你有没有考虑过这些呢?

XX工作的时候,刚开始自己做一些维护工作。那时候,自己不是很开心,总觉得工作有点太简单了,自己的能力不止能干这个。做事不免有点不是很上心。但到后来的时候,同事检查我的代码,说了好多的问题,基本上我写的代码一无事处。

你这用循环查库吗,这样效率得多低啊。考虑一下能不能批量的查询,只访问一下库,减少数据库压力,提升效率;

这个方法的方法体也太长了吧,考虑一下能不能把某些逻辑给分离出去,缩短一下方法的长度;

这个循环嵌套太长了,考虑精简一下;

这个你是怎么考虑的啊,用户这样用着方便吗?考虑一下易用性的问题

这个逻辑好多地方都用了吧,看看能不能提出个公共的方法。

还是需要多写点注释啊

有些时候,你明白了需求,并把逻辑代码给写出来了,你就在沾沾自喜了吗?你有考虑过代码的质量吗?易读性,易维护性,易用性等都需要码农来考虑。

在你接手一个任务时,尤其是刚开始接手不久,不要过于的抬高自己,你要学习的东西还是有很多。做完之后,多找大牛帮你看一下,以免为自己以后的工作留下隐患。

做个好码农,也没那么容易。理论不是用来说的,是用来做的。当我们写代码的时候,多考虑一下这些问题。不要轻视某一件工作,认认真真踏踏实实还是很重要的。

优质内容筛选与推荐>>
1、Scala语言学习笔记二
2、来自Centrify的预测:2018年的网络安全
3、WARNutil.NativeCodeLoader:Unabletoloadnative-hadooplibraryforyourplatform...usingbuiltin-
4、增删改查不是万能的,但是万万不能没有增删改查——限信息管理类
5、人工智能时代最合适的语言,Python终于玩大了!


长按二维码向我转账

受苹果公司新规定影响,微信 iOS 版的赞赏功能被关闭,可通过二维码转账支持公众号。

    阅读
    好看
    已推荐到看一看
    你的朋友可以在“发现”-“看一看”看到你认为好看的文章。
    已取消,“好看”想法已同步删除
    已推荐到看一看 和朋友分享想法
    最多200字,当前共 发送

    已发送

    朋友将在看一看看到

    确定
    分享你的想法...
    取消

    分享想法到看一看

    确定
    最多200字,当前共

    发送中

    网络异常,请稍后重试

    微信扫一扫
    关注该公众号